I saw alot of people wanted to know about this so I decided to help, maybe sisi yemmie will still respond though. so basically wedding introduction is a simple formal ceremony where the groom’s and bride's family members officially get to know one another. From what I can recall, some 10 years ago it used to be done in the living room mostly with just nuclear family and very close extended families in attendance and very good friends of the couple. The couples would wear similar clothing. Nowadays its much larger, friends and family even pick similar clothes(asoebi) to wear and event halls are used for the ceremony instead of the house. Traditional wedding is the wedding proper, where the groom pays the bride price, takes the bride officially and she is welcome into the new family plus all the other rites, a much larger crowd is present and there's usually asoebi meaning almost everyone has the same materials for their clothes and headgear(gele). The white wedding is just a borrowed thing as a result of Christianity coming through the whites so we sorta adopted it. Here after being joined in a church building, there would be a wedding reception to entertain guests. That being said its hungrying me to be part of a party planning😥. Normally introduction shouldn't be this elaborate but time has change alot of things..it's basically when the groom family comes to meet the bride' family, make their intention known then pick a date for the actual wedding. The women u see collecting money from the groom n his friends are like senior wives in d bride'family. Like their way of welcoming him or saying he can't just come like that n take a beautiful lady from their family without giving them something. Every other things is just formality, the main event is introducing the bride to d grooms family n vice versa.. hope u understand
